UGA Choral Day - FRIDAY, September 25, 2026 UGA Choral Day is a wonderful and unique opportunity for singers in grades 9-12 to rehearse and perform in our world-class facilities, to work with and make personal connections with our conducting, music education, and voice faculties, and to enjoy the fellowship and artistic camaraderie of the collegiate singers of many of UGA’s fine choirs. Choral teachers and their students will enjoy a recital presented by UGA voice students. Registration information and further details about the day’s activities and expectations are included below.
